Apple ARKit
Apple ARKit is a sophisticated augmented reality framework that allows you to create immersive experiences for iOS and iPadOS by integrating digital objects with the physical world.
echo3D
echo3D is a 3D asset management platform that helps you store, manage, and stream 3D content to any mobile, web, or AR/VR application through a global cloud infrastructure.
Quick Comparison
| Feature | Apple ARKit | echo3D |
|---|---|---|
| Website | developer.apple.com | echo3d.com |
| Pricing Model | Freemium | Freemium |
| Starting Price | Free | Free |
| FREE Trial | ✘ No free trial | ✓ 7 days free trial |
| Free Plan | ✓ Has free plan | ✓ Has free plan |
| Product Demo | ✓ Request demo here | ✓ Request demo here |
| Deployment | ||
| Integrations | ||
| Target Users | ||
| Target Industries | ||
| Customer Count | 0 | 0 |
| Founded Year | 1976 | 2018 |
| Headquarters | Cupertino, USA | New York, USA |
Overview
Apple ARKit
Apple ARKit is a powerful framework that lets you build high-quality augmented reality experiences for iPhone and iPad. By combining device motion tracking, camera scene capture, and advanced scene processing, you can place virtual content into the real world with incredible realism. You can use it to create everything from immersive gaming environments and interactive retail visualizations to professional industrial design tools that respond naturally to the environment.
The platform provides you with the tools to track people, detect planes, and estimate lighting in real-time. Whether you are a solo developer or part of a large studio, ARKit simplifies the complexities of computer vision so you can focus on the creative aspects of your app. It integrates deeply with Apple's hardware, ensuring your AR apps run smoothly and efficiently across millions of supported devices.
echo3D
echo3D is a specialized cloud platform designed to handle the heavy lifting of 3D content management. You can upload your 3D models, animations, and interactive assets to a centralized hub, where they are automatically optimized for different devices and platforms. This eliminates the need for you to build complex backend infrastructure or manually convert file formats for every new project.
The platform allows you to stream 3D content directly to your apps, much like a 2D image CDN, which significantly reduces your app's initial download size. Whether you are building an AR retail experience, a VR training simulation, or a 3D web configurator, you can manage your entire asset library through a simple web interface and update your live applications in real-time without requiring users to download updates.
Overview
Apple ARKit Features
- World Tracking Track your device's position and orientation in space with high precision to keep virtual objects locked in place.
- Scene Geometry Create a topological map of your space to enable virtual objects to interact realistically with floors, walls, and furniture.
- Instant Placement Place virtual objects on real-world surfaces instantly without waiting for the camera to map the entire room first.
- Image and Object Detection Recognize 2D images or 3D objects in the environment to trigger specific AR experiences or informational overlays.
- Face Tracking Apply realistic filters or track facial expressions in real-time using the TrueDepth camera for expressive AR characters.
- People Occlusion Allow virtual content to pass behind or in front of people in the real world for a more immersive experience.
- Light Estimation Match the lighting of your virtual objects to the actual ambient light of the room for seamless visual integration.
- Collaborative Sessions Share your AR world map with other users so you can build and interact in the same space together.
echo3D Features
- 3D Asset Streaming. Stream 3D content directly to your apps from the cloud to keep your initial app download size small and performance high.
- Automatic Optimization. Convert and compress your 3D models automatically to ensure they work perfectly across iOS, Android, and web browsers.
- Real-time Updates. Change your 3D assets in the web console and see the updates reflected instantly in your live applications.
- Web-based AR. Create and share augmented reality experiences that your users can view instantly through a simple web link or QR code.
- Global CDN. Deliver your 3D content through a global network of servers to ensure low latency and fast loading for users everywhere.
- Cross-platform SDKs. Integrate your 3D library quickly with ready-to-use SDKs for Unity, Unreal Engine, Niantic Lightship, and standard web frameworks.
Pricing Comparison
Apple ARKit Pricing
- Access to ARKit framework
- On-device testing
- Reality Composer access
- Documentation and guides
- Developer forums access
- Everything in Free, plus:
- App Store distribution
- Advanced App Capabilities
- Beta software access
- App Store Connect analytics
- Technical support incidents
echo3D Pricing
- 100 MB storage
- 1 GB bandwidth
- Up to 100 entries
- Community support
- Standard CDN delivery
- Everything in Free, plus:
- 1 GB storage
- 10 GB bandwidth
- Up to 1,000 entries
- Email support
- Advanced analytics
Pros & Cons
Apple ARKit
Pros
- Unmatched performance on iOS hardware
- Excellent documentation and sample code
- Seamless integration with RealityKit
- Industry-leading motion tracking accuracy
- Regular updates with new features
Cons
- Limited strictly to Apple ecosystem
- Requires latest hardware for best features
- High learning curve for complex geometry
- Annual fee required for store publishing
echo3D
Pros
- Simplifies 3D file conversion across multiple platforms
- Significantly reduces mobile app package sizes
- Easy to use for non-technical team members
- Fast deployment for web-based AR experiences
Cons
- Bandwidth limits can be reached quickly
- Documentation for advanced features is sometimes sparse
- Learning curve for complex Unity integrations